Mudslinging Continues To Heat Up Court Clerk’s Race

With early voting already underway, the race for Cook County Circuit Court Clerk – an office which employs over 2,000 people and operates with a $100 million budget – has become one of the most exciting to watch amid continued charges of scandal and ethically dubious behavior.

The latest sees challenger Chicago Ald. Ricardo Munoz (22nd) blasting 12-year incumbent Dorothy Brown’s decision to award what he calls a “sweetheart, no-bid” contract to a campaign donor.

ICE Detainer Ordinance Could Stay Intact

The author of an amendment that would significantly change Cook County’s immigration detainer ordinance told Progress Illinois Wednesday that he doesn’t have the votes now on the 17-member Cook County Board of Commissioners to pass the amendment.

“Between five to eight commissioners support my amendment,” said Timothy Schneider, a Republican from Bartlett.
